Barrio Anglo is a village in the Río Negro Department of Uruguay.
Geography
[edit | edit source]It is located just across the stream Arroyo Fray Bentos from Fray Bentos, the capital of the department, being a western barrio (neighbourhood) of the city.
Population
[edit | edit source]In 2011 Barrio Anglo had a population of 785.[1]
| Year | Population |
|---|---|
| 1963 | 627 |
| 1975 | 708 |
| 1985 | 273 |
| 1996 | 664 |
| 2004 | 818 |
| 2011 | 785 |
Source: National Statistics Institute[2]
